The renowned artist Christian Ward makes his debut as writer and artist in Arkham Ghost, a work published by Panini Comics for DC that delves into the minds of Gotham's most unsettling villains with an innovative approach to psychological horror and experimental art. 🃏

An Immersion into Gotham's Madness

This original story explores the darkest corners of Arkham Asylum, taking readers on a psychological journey through the disturbed minds that inhabit its cells. The narrative focuses on mental terror rather than physical.

Key Narrative Elements:
  • Focus on the psychological development of the villains
  • Claustrophobic setting within Arkham Asylum
  • Exploration of the traumas that generate madness

Christian Ward's Experimental Art

Ward's distinctive style reaches new levels of expression in this work. His use of vibrant colors, abstract compositions, and mixed techniques creates a visual experience that directly reflects the characters' mental instability.

Artistic Innovations Present:
  • Psychedelic and unconventional color palettes
  • Compositions that break from traditional formats
  • Use of textures and experimental techniques
